Duties and Responsibilities

  • Works with experienced departmental staff to learn actuarial techniques, data sources, and spreadsheets to conduct reviews of rating factors.
  • Assists in conducting detailed analysis of The ERIE's insurance programs, profitability, rating factors, reserve studies, dynamic financial analysis, and experience exhibits. Typical projects have included: deductible studies, trend and forecasts of average paid losses and frequencies, effect of large losses on rate indications, and competitive analysis.
  • Creates exhibits, reports, and charts for actuarial and reserve studies, state insurance department filings, and rate recommendations. Determines appropriate presentation format.
  • Develops a basic knowledge of ratemaking procedures used by The ERIE, competitors, and rate bureaus. Writes programs in SAS and Visual Basic to extract data to spreadsheet format. Reviews data for reasonableness and accuracy.
  • Gathers ERIE and Industry information in response to requests. Presents rate, reserve and other analysis to management and communicates analysis impacts to other departments as required.
